DUBAI, MANILA- Middle East carrier Emirates (EK) and Philippine Airlines (PR) have broadened their existing interline agreement, ushering in a new phase of collaboration.
This enhancement enables Emirates travelers to gain access to domestic destinations within the Philippine Airlines network via multiple gateways, including Cebu and Clark, in addition to the previously established interline connections via Manila.

This strategic partnership encompasses all three major gateways served by Emirates in the Philippines – namely, Manila, Cebu, and Clark.
By expanding this collaboration, passengers are set to experience seamless connectivity, granting them the ability to effortlessly reach an extended array of destinations across the Philippines by utilizing a single ticket and benefiting from a unified baggage policy.
Passengers flying with Emirates will enjoy a streamlined booking process that grants them access to various destinations within Philippine Airlines’ network.
Notably, this includes points such as Bacolod, Butuan, Cagayan De Oro, Davao, Iloilo, Caticlan, and Puerto Princesa through the gateway of Cebu.
Furthermore, destinations such as Cebu, Caticlan, and Busuanga can be reached via Clark, thereby offering travelers enhanced accessibility and flexibility across the Philippines.

The extended interline agreement also presents advantages for Philippine Airlines’ passengers, as they can now take advantage of the expanded network and book flights operated by Emirates to a variety of destinations.
This includes cities such as Amman, Birmingham, Cape Town, Dammam, Dublin, Lisbon, Manchester, Muscat, and Riyadh via the Dubai hub.
Notably, Philippine Airlines maintains daily flights between Manila and Dubai, which facilitates smooth and efficient connections to various cities across Europe, Africa, and other parts of the Middle East.
This comprehensive arrangement ensures that passengers can receive their boarding passes and check their baggage through to their final destinations, streamlining their travel experience.
The expansion of this collaboration follows several months after the initial announcement of the interline agreement between Emirates and Philippine Airlines.
This development underscores the shared commitment of both carriers to address the evolving demands of travelers by offering increased choices, flexibility, and enhanced customer satisfaction.
Emirates’ presence in the Philippines dates back to 1990, with the airline currently operating 25 weekly flights connecting Manila, Cebu, and Clark.
Notably, Emirates is distinguished as the sole air carrier to provide First-Class accommodations on flights to Manila, catering to premium passengers in the market.
With a robust network of 29 codeshare partners and 110 interline alliances, Emirates’ influence extends beyond its routes, facilitating greater connectivity and convenience for travelers worldwide.
